The noise in the shadow regions is usually a result of trying to pull information out of the toe of the image. Small cameras like the hvx and jvc have small sensors and small photosites, and thus in order to get more information in the shadows in low light situations they have to boost the signal thus resulting in noise...

 

Luckily, it seems that a high contrast situation such as the one you're illustrating does not require that you hold the shadow information. As long as you light the actors brightly you can crush the shadow detail to solid black (either in post or in camera)

 

I believe you could easily get solid blacks from the jvc or hvx like this, but I encourage you to do a test first.

A lot depends on your budget IMO.

 

I will go from what I know which are all under the $10,000 range and if you are using the GRHD1, then I know you are working with a conservative budget. From top to bottom is my list.

 

 

1. Sony PMW-EX3 (Like someone else mentioned shooting uncompressed is the best for any situation, but don't forget to add SXS cards into your budget)

 

2. Sony PMW-EX1 (Same recording format as the EX3 minus some features, and will save you more money). I have seen these shoot in super low light and work perfectly.

 

 

3. Sony HVR-Z7U (It picks up picture at 1.5 LUX, lowest of the HDV cameras and also supports recording uncompressed with it's compact flash storage unit.

 

 

4. Sony HVR-Z5U, Z1U, or FX-1, these mid range work phenomenally well in low light.

 

I recommend sony for this because they have worked the best for me and my friends in every low light situation / problem, we've had.

 

 

The HVX200 will work with High Gain, but still needs more light.

 

Based you put up, a lot of cameras have a spotlight feature on them, which is meant for those type of situations (a hard contrast between darks and lights).
